What does it really take to add batteries to a solar system?
Battery storage isn’t just about buying a battery and plugging it in—it requires thoughtful engineering to ensure performance, safety, and compliance with local regulations.
Here are some engineering considerations for Solar Battery Systems:
🔹 Load and Backup Requirements: Engineers evaluate which loads need backup and for how long. This helps determine the size and type of battery system needed.
🔹 System Integration & Compatibility: Batteries must work in sync with solar inverters and existing electrical infrastructure. Engineers ensure smooth communication and operation between all components.
🔹 Safety & Code Compliance: From proper ventilation to fire safety and interconnection rules, engineers design systems that meet strict codes and safety standards.
Of course, these are just a few highlights. Battery design gets even more technical when you factor in grid interaction, charge/discharge profiles, and lifecycle planning.
